The Cost Factors: A Deeper Dive

The price tag of your homemade tote bag is influenced by a number of factors, from the materials you choose to the amount of time you invest. Let’s break down these key elements:

1. Fabric: This is arguably the most significant cost factor. The fabric you choose can range from inexpensive cotton to luxurious linen or even upcycled materials.

  • Cotton: A budget-friendly option, cotton fabric can be found for as little as $5 per yard.
  • Linen: A natural and durable choice, linen typically costs between $10 and $20 per yard.
  • Upcycled materials: Repurposing old t-shirts, curtains, or even jeans can be a cost-effective and eco-friendly approach.

2. Hardware: Handles, zippers, and other hardware add to the overall cost.

  • Handles: You can choose from a variety of materials, from simple cotton webbing to leather straps.
  • Zippers: Metal zippers are more durable but also more expensive than plastic ones.
  • Other hardware: Consider the cost of buttons, snaps, or decorative accents.

3. Sewing Supplies: Don’t underestimate the cost of essential sewing supplies like thread, needles, and pins.

4. Time: While you might not be directly paying for your time, it’s crucial to factor it in. The complexity of the design and your sewing skills will influence how much time you spend on the project.

Calculating the Cost: A Practical Example

Let’s assume you’re making a basic tote bag with cotton fabric, cotton webbing handles, and a simple zipper closure. Here’s a rough estimate of the costs:

  • Fabric: $5 per yard (assuming you need 1 yard) = $5
  • Handles: $3 per pair
  • Zipper: $2
  • Thread, needles, pins: $2
  • Time: Let’s say you spend 2 hours on the project, and you value your time at $15 per hour = $30

Total Estimated Cost: $5 + $3 + $2 + $2 + $30 = $42

Cost-Saving Strategies: Making It Affordable

While a homemade tote bag can be a worthwhile investment, it’s also possible to make it more affordable. Here are some cost-saving strategies:

  • Shop for fabric sales: Keep an eye out for discounts at fabric stores or online retailers.
  • Use upcycled materials: Repurposing old clothes or household items can significantly reduce your costs.
  • Choose simple designs: A basic tote bag with minimal embellishments will require less time and effort.
  • Consider DIY hardware: You can create your own handles from old belts or fabric scraps.
  • Utilize your existing supplies: If you already have thread, needles, and pins, you can save on these costs.

Answers to Your Most Common Questions

Q: How much does it cost to make a tote bag with canvas fabric?

A: Canvas fabric is typically more expensive than cotton, costing around $10-$15 per yard. The total cost will depend on the size of the tote bag and the other materials used.

Q: Can I use a sewing machine to make a tote bag?

A: Yes, a sewing machine is highly recommended for making a tote bag, especially if you’re using heavier fabrics. However, it’s possible to make a tote bag by hand if you prefer.
